What is a Bimetal Thermostat?

A bimetal thermostat is a temperature-regulating device composed of two strips of different metals bonded together. These metals have different coefficients of thermal expansion, meaning they expand and contract at different rates when subjected to temperature changes. This characteristic is pivotal to the operation of the bimetal thermostat, as it allows the device to react effectively to variations in temperature. As the temperature rises, the metal strip with the higher coefficient of thermal expansion expands more than the other, causing the bimetal strip to bend or curl. This movement can either open or close an electrical contact, thereby initiating or interrupting the flow of current to an appliance or system. Conversely, as the temperature drops, the bimetal strip returns to its original position, which can also cause the opposite effect on the electrical contacts.
